By scheduling a visit in January, you're visiting during a month that often has smaller crowds because it's right after the holiday season. The weather can sometimes be warm but there's also a possibility of some cool days. I usually bring layers with me just in case!
Celebrating birthdays are a lot of fun at Disney World. First, make sure your birthday girl gets a birthday button from a Cast Member. When she wears it, she'll hear so many people say, "Happy birthday, Princess!" My daughter loves that. You can see a long list of celebration ideas from
Disney Floral and Gifts. Some of the other ways we've celebrated includes a special dinner at a
Table Service Restaurant of her choice, a visit to the
Bibbidi Bobbidi Boutique and we've attended a dessert party of two. (Our favorite is the
Wishes Fireworks Dessert Party.)
